Transaction 988cf63cd743f8f429fe4a478283a032f77e3d2b5e51ecc346327296911b526a

1 Input
2 Outputs
  • 988cf63cd743f8f429fe4a478283a032f77e3d2b5e51ecc346327296911b526a:0
  • value  26750000
    address  3MaUeyFEaKQWuo8tSmiAuhrYJSsMkbqBGo
  • 988cf63cd743f8f429fe4a478283a032f77e3d2b5e51ecc346327296911b526a:1
  • value  7711237
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n